src/tools/closeout.ts Normal file
View File

@ -0,0 +1,129 @@
import type { WorkstreamCloseoutInput, WorkstreamReusablePattern } from '../types.js';
import { workstreamReusablePatternValues } from '../core/constants.js';
import { defaultReviewProjects } from './review.js';
interface UpgradeTarget {
files: string[];
label: string;
prompt: string;
}
const upgradeTargets = {
blocker: {
files: ['src/tools/blocker.ts', 'src/tools/workflow.ts', 'README.md'],
label: '卡点固化',
prompt: '把重复失败的命令、稳定解法、停止条件和后续入口沉淀成 kt_blocker_resolution 或收尾规则。',
},
cleanup: {
files: ['src/tools/cleanup.ts', 'src/tools/verification.ts', 'README.md'],
label: '清理需求',
prompt: '把历史产物、验证进程或远程临时目录清理变成可复用命令或验证提醒。',
},
'command-template': {
files: ['src/tools/workflow.ts', 'src/tools/testing.ts', 'scripts/'],
label: '命令模板',
prompt: '把反复使用且容易写错的命令模板封装到工作流、业务测试计划或脚本。',
},
'deploy-observation': {
files: ['src/tools/workflow.ts', 'src/tools/testing.ts', 'README.md'],
label: '部署观测',
prompt: '把 Jenkins/K8s build、commit、镜像、Deployment、Pod、日志和 smoke 观测步骤写成固定计划。',
},
none: {
files: [],
label: '无可执行升级',
prompt: '明确说明本轮没有新的可复用流程、误报、清理或命令模板需要沉淀。',
},
'review-false-positive': {
files: ['src/tools/review.ts', 'src/selfTest.ts', 'README.md'],
label: '复审误报',
prompt: '把已确认的误报规则沉淀到 review 过滤器和 self-test避免后续污染上下文。',
},
'test-flow': {
files: ['src/tools/testing.ts', 'scripts/', 'README.md'],
label: '测试链路',
prompt: '把新的真实接口、页面、QQBot、部署或业务 smoke 流程加入测试计划或脚本。',
},
} satisfies Record<WorkstreamReusablePattern, UpgradeTarget>;
function normalizeList(values?: string[]): string[] {
return (values || []).map((value) => value.trim()).filter(Boolean);
}
function normalizePatterns(values?: WorkstreamReusablePattern[]): WorkstreamReusablePattern[] {
const validValues = new Set<WorkstreamReusablePattern>(workstreamReusablePatternValues);
const uniqueValues = Array.from(
new Set((values || []).filter((value) => validValues.has(value))),
);
const patterns: WorkstreamReusablePattern[] = uniqueValues.length > 0 ? uniqueValues : ['none'];
return patterns.length > 1 ? patterns.filter((pattern) => pattern !== 'none') : patterns;
}
function buildPhase(name: string, evidence: string[], emptyHint: string): Record<string, unknown> {
return {
evidence,
name,
status: evidence.length > 0 ? 'ok' : 'missing',
suggestion: evidence.length > 0 ? undefined : emptyHint,
};
}
export function buildWorkstreamCloseout(input: WorkstreamCloseoutInput = {}): Record<string, unknown> {
const title = input.title?.trim() || '';
const changedProjects = normalizeList(input.changedProjects);
const verificationEvidence = normalizeList(input.verificationEvidence);
const problemRecords = normalizeList(input.problemRecords);
const stableSolutions = normalizeList(input.stableSolutions);
const patterns = normalizePatterns(input.reusablePatterns);
const upgradeNeeded = patterns.some((pattern) => pattern !== 'none');
const ktWorkflowUpdated = input.ktWorkflowUpdated === true;
const missingItems = [
title ? '' : '填写本轮大方向名称或目标。',
verificationEvidence.length > 0 ? '' : '补充测试或 smoke 验证证据;只有计划不算闭环完成。',
problemRecords.length > 0 ? '' : '补充问题记录;如无新卡点,显式写“无新卡点”。',
stableSolutions.length > 0 ? '' : '补充稳定解法;如无新解法,显式写“无新增稳定解法”。',
upgradeNeeded && !ktWorkflowUpdated
? '本轮识别到可复用模式,先升级 ktWorkflow 对应规则或脚本,再报告完成。'
: '',
].filter(Boolean);
const targetProjects = changedProjects.length > 0 ? changedProjects : [...defaultReviewProjects];
const selectedUpgradeTargets = patterns.map((pattern) => ({
pattern,
...upgradeTargets[pattern],
}));
return {
canReportComplete: missingItems.length === 0,
closeoutOrder: [
buildPhase('development', title ? [title] : [], '写清本轮完成的开发目标。'),
buildPhase('test/smoke verification', verificationEvidence, '补一条可复验的验证证据。'),
buildPhase('problem record', problemRecords, '记录问题点;没有问题也要显式写明。'),
buildPhase('stable solution', stableSolutions, '记录稳定解法;没有新增解法也要显式写明。'),
{
evidence: upgradeNeeded
? [
ktWorkflowUpdated
? input.upgradeNotes || '已升级 ktWorkflow。'
: '待升级 ktWorkflow。',
]
: [input.upgradeNotes || '无新的可执行 ktWorkflow 升级需求。'],
name: 'ktWorkflow upgrade',
status: upgradeNeeded ? (ktWorkflowUpdated ? 'ok' : 'missing') : 'not-needed',
},
],
commands: [
'git status --short',
'pnpm run typecheck',
'pnpm run self-test',
'pnpm run global-review',
'git diff --check',
],
missingItems,
patterns,
targetProjects,
title: title || '未命名大方向',
upgradeNeeded,
upgradeTargets: selectedUpgradeTargets,
};
}
